Charity supports Purple Heart recipients

The Wounded Warriors in Action Foundation (WWIA) is a 501c3 nonprofit organization that was started in 2007 to serve our military heroes that have returned home after being wounded in combat.  

Much more than a handshake or ovation at a ball game; WWIA takes these Purple Heart recipients on weekend-long events in small group settings with a senior mentor in order to provide them with world-class hunting and fishing experiences with other Wounded Warriors. This allows them to experience the mental and physical healing powers of the great outdoors.  Additionally, they can reengage in the camaraderie of shared soldier experiences in the military. Doing something new or fulfilling a lifetime goal such as bagging the big fish or getting a nine point buck provides a much-needed confidence boost.

The personal and professional lives of these Heroes have changed dramatically. WWIA strives to show these phenomenal Heroes that they can once again live meaningful lives and accomplish many milestones despite their current circumstances. Since most of our Heroes are struggling financially and would not be able to otherwise afford this once-in-a-lifetime healing opportunity, we have found that these opportunities can assist them on their healing journey.

WWIA has had the honor of serving many Wounded Warrior Heroes in 35 different states, Mexico and British Columbia.  Because of the generosity of the American public, we have been able to provide and facilitate these events for over seven years. WWIA is also able to make sure the Heroes have the opportunity to interact with the community, demonstrating that their sacrifices are truly appreciated, and adding a positive dimension to their healing process.

One Hero mentions that the chance to be around other soldiers who shared some of the same experiences truly helped his road to recovery.  When he added in the feeling of accomplishment at the end of the hunt and the fact that Americans had not forgotten his sacrifices, he says it was an “awesome life experience.” Another Hero commented that he came to this hunt “depressed about life” but came away “encouraged to live his dreams and strive to always do the right things.” Finally, a volunteer from a recent event said of the Heroes in attendance, “The healing process that took place during the event – you could just see the magic. It was unbelievable.”
